On 6/17/26 12:50 AM, Michal Pecio wrote:
> On Tue, 16 Jun 2026 20:22:19 +0330, Amin Vakil wrote:
>> On 6/16/26 8:06 PM, Michal Pecio wrote:
>>> RTL8153 was one of the chips specifically targeted by this fix, but
>>> it affects the CDC configuration which you don't seem to be using.
>>>
>>> I have tried linux-hardened-7.0.12.hardened1-1-x86_64 from Arch repo
>>> as well as my own build of 7.1-rc6, and my RTL8153 (0bda:8153) in a
>>> different kind of USB-C dock still works with a few xHCI controllers.
>>>
>>> So it's some weird problem narrowly specific to your system. Now that
>>> you have built your own kernel, please also revert the suspect patch
>>> to verify if that's really it.
>>
>> Honestly I've tried patching it myself :)
>>
>> by changing
>>
>> (le16_to_cpu(desc->wBytesPerInterval) < usb_endpoint_maxp(&ep->desc) &&
>>
>> to
>>
>> (le16_to_cpu(desc->wBytesPerInterval) == 0 &&
>>
>> in line 187 of drivers/usb/core/config.c to see if that fixes the issue
>> and it did not, but I didn't specifically reverted the commit to see if
>> that fixes the issue.
> 
> This should be enough to prevent overriding wBytesPerInterval on
> RTL8153 (and get rid of the new log message).
> 
> If the message goes away but the device still doesn't work, the problem
> must be somewhere else.
> 
> I would start with userspace - if you haven't already, downgrade to
> some kernel package which worked in the past. See if it still works.
> Or check if 9ddb9c0deca48d2c2a22ebf4d2f35c925a520328 applies to your
> dock and try reverting it if it does.
> 
> Otherwise, no idea, besides git-bisect I guess.

The problem is something with usbguard all the way :)

Disabling usbguard fixed the issue and it's now working on 7.1 
correctly. Sorry for the noise.

The problem was a stale usbguard policy blocking the hub, updating 
usbguard policy with new hash fixed that as well.

Again I'm sorry for the noise and thank you for time.
